Creating Strong and Secure Passwords: A Comprehensive Guide

In today’s digital age, passwords are the gatekeepers to our online lives. They protect our personal information, financial data, and professional accounts. Creating strong and secure passwords is no longer a suggestion; it’s a necessity. This comprehensive guide will walk you through the process of crafting robust passwords, managing them effectively, and understanding the threats that lurk in the digital world.

Understanding the Importance of Strong Passwords

The primary function of a password is to verify your identity and grant you access to a specific account or system. A weak password is like leaving your front door unlocked – it invites unauthorized access. Cybercriminals employ various techniques to crack passwords, including brute-force attacks, dictionary attacks, and phishing scams.

A brute-force attack involves systematically trying every possible combination of characters until the correct password is found. The more complex your password, the longer it takes to crack using this method.

Dictionary attacks use a list of commonly used words and phrases, along with variations and common misspellings, to guess passwords. Avoid using words found in dictionaries or easily guessable phrases.

Phishing scams involve tricking users into revealing their passwords through deceptive emails, websites, or messages. Always be cautious of suspicious links and requests for your personal information.

Crafting a Strong Password: The Fundamentals

Creating a strong password requires a combination of techniques to make it difficult to guess or crack. A strong password should be:

  • Long and complex: Aim for at least 12 characters, and preferably longer.
  • Unique: Avoid reusing the same password across multiple accounts.
  • Unpredictable: Don’t use personal information like your name, birthdate, or pet’s name.

Length Matters: The Longer, the Better

Password length is arguably the most critical factor in determining its strength. A longer password significantly increases the number of possible combinations, making it exponentially harder to crack. While shorter passwords might seem easier to remember, they are far more vulnerable to attack.

Complexity is Key: Mixing Characters

A strong password should incorporate a variety of character types, including uppercase letters, lowercase letters, numbers, and symbols. This increases the character set and makes it more difficult for attackers to guess the password. A password composed of only lowercase letters is significantly weaker than one that includes a mix of uppercase and lowercase letters, numbers, and symbols.

Consider these examples:

  • Weak: password123 (easily guessable)
  • Better: P@sswOrd123 (slightly better but still predictable)
  • Strong: T3!s#a9@$lK2mZ (much more secure)

Uniqueness: Avoid Password Reuse

Reusing the same password across multiple accounts is a risky practice. If one of your accounts is compromised, all accounts using the same password are at risk. Each account should have a unique, strong password to minimize the potential damage from a data breach. Consider using a password manager to help you generate and store unique passwords for each account.

Advanced Password Creation Techniques

Beyond the basic principles of length, complexity, and uniqueness, there are advanced techniques you can use to create even stronger passwords. These techniques focus on making your passwords less predictable and more resistant to various cracking methods.

Passphrases: The Power of Multiple Words

A passphrase is a sequence of words that form a memorable but difficult-to-guess phrase. Passphrases are often more secure than traditional passwords because they are longer and less likely to be found in dictionaries.

For example, instead of using a single word like “sunflower,” you could use a passphrase like “The red sunflower grew slowly.”

Randomization: Embrace the Unpredictable

Randomly generated passwords are the most secure option. These passwords are created using algorithms that generate a string of characters with no discernible pattern. While these passwords are difficult to remember, they are virtually impossible to guess. Password managers can generate and store random passwords for you.

Mnemonics: Creating Memorable Passwords

Mnemonics are memory aids that can help you remember complex passwords. One technique is to create a sentence and use the first letter of each word to form your password, adding numbers and symbols for extra security.

For example, the sentence “My dog has 4 black spots and loves to eat bacon!” could be transformed into the password “MdH4bs&l2eB!”.

Leet Speak: A Decryption Obstacle

Leet speak involves substituting letters with numbers or symbols that resemble them. While not foolproof, it can add an extra layer of complexity to your passwords. For example, “password” could become “p@$$w0rd” or “pa55w0rd”. However, avoid overly common leet substitutions, as they are easily recognized by password cracking tools.

Password Management: Keeping Your Passwords Safe

Creating strong passwords is only half the battle. You also need to manage them effectively to prevent them from being lost, stolen, or compromised.

Password Managers: Your Digital Vault

A password manager is a software application that securely stores your passwords and other sensitive information. Password managers can generate strong, random passwords, automatically fill in login credentials on websites and apps, and sync your passwords across multiple devices.

Popular password managers include:

  • LastPass
  • 1Password
  • Dashlane
  • Bitwarden

Two-Factor Authentication: Adding an Extra Layer of Security

Two-factor authentication (2FA) adds an extra layer of security to your accounts by requiring a second form of verification in addition to your password. This could be a code sent to your phone via SMS, a code generated by an authenticator app, or a biometric scan. Even if someone steals your password, they won’t be able to access your account without the second factor of authentication.

Regular Password Updates: A Proactive Approach

It’s good practice to update your passwords regularly, especially for your most important accounts. This helps to mitigate the risk of compromised passwords, even if there hasn’t been a known security breach. Consider setting reminders to update your passwords every three to six months.

Secure Storage: Keeping Passwords Offline

If you prefer not to use a password manager, you can store your passwords offline in a secure location. This could be a physical notebook kept in a safe place or an encrypted file on your computer. Never store your passwords in plain text or in an easily accessible location.

Password Security Best Practices

Beyond the specific techniques for creating and managing passwords, there are general best practices that you should follow to maintain your online security.

Avoid Sharing Passwords: Keep Them Private

Never share your passwords with anyone, even friends or family members. If someone needs access to an account, create a separate account for them with their own unique password.

Be Wary of Phishing Scams: Verify Before You Click

Be cautious of suspicious emails, websites, or messages that ask for your password. Always verify the legitimacy of the source before entering your credentials. Look for red flags such as misspellings, grammatical errors, and urgent requests.

Use Secure Networks: Avoid Public Wi-Fi

Avoid entering your passwords on public Wi-Fi networks, as these networks are often unsecured and vulnerable to eavesdropping. If you must use a public Wi-Fi network, use a virtual private network (VPN) to encrypt your internet traffic.

Keep Software Updated: Patch Security Vulnerabilities

Keep your operating system, web browser, and other software up to date. Software updates often include security patches that fix vulnerabilities that could be exploited by attackers.

Monitor Your Accounts: Detect Suspicious Activity

Regularly monitor your accounts for suspicious activity, such as unauthorized logins or unusual transactions. If you notice anything suspicious, change your password immediately and contact the service provider.

The Future of Passwords: Beyond Traditional Methods

The traditional password is not a perfect security solution. It is susceptible to various attacks and can be difficult for users to manage effectively. As technology evolves, new methods of authentication are emerging that promise to be more secure and user-friendly.

Biometrics: Using Unique Biological Traits

Biometrics uses unique biological traits, such as fingerprints, facial recognition, and iris scans, to verify identity. Biometric authentication is generally more secure than passwords because it is difficult to forge or steal.

Passwordless Authentication: Eliminating Passwords Entirely

Passwordless authentication eliminates the need for passwords altogether. Instead, it relies on other methods of verification, such as biometrics, security keys, or one-time codes sent to your device.

Multi-Factor Authentication Evolution: Adaptive Authentication

Adaptive authentication takes multi-factor authentication a step further by dynamically adjusting the security requirements based on the context of the login attempt. For example, if you are logging in from a new device or location, you may be required to provide additional verification.

Conclusion: Taking Control of Your Password Security

Creating strong and secure passwords is an ongoing process that requires vigilance and effort. By following the guidelines outlined in this guide, you can significantly improve your online security and protect your valuable information. Remember to prioritize password length, complexity, and uniqueness, and to manage your passwords effectively using a password manager and two-factor authentication. Stay informed about the latest security threats and best practices, and be proactive in protecting your digital identity. Your password security is your responsibility, and it is an investment in your overall online safety and well-being.

Why are strong passwords important?

Strong passwords are the first line of defense against unauthorized access to your online accounts and personal information. A weak or easily guessed password makes you vulnerable to hacking attempts, which can result in identity theft, financial losses, and compromised data. Protecting your digital life starts with creating passwords that are difficult for attackers to crack, even with sophisticated tools.

Using strong and unique passwords for each of your accounts minimizes the risk of a successful breach. If one account is compromised due to a weak password, attackers might try using the same password on your other accounts. A strong, unique password for each account ensures that a breach on one platform doesn’t grant access to all your online presence.

What makes a password strong?

A strong password typically consists of a combination of uppercase and lowercase letters, numbers, and symbols. The length is also critical; longer passwords are significantly harder to crack. Avoid using personal information like your name, birthdate, or pet’s name, as these are easily accessible and predictable.

Randomness is key. A truly strong password should be a seemingly random sequence of characters. Using password generators can help create passwords that are both long and random. Avoid using dictionary words or common phrases, even with modifications, as they are vulnerable to dictionary attacks.

How long should my password be?

Ideally, your password should be at least 12 characters long, but longer is always better. Modern password cracking techniques can quickly compromise shorter passwords, even those with mixed character types. Aiming for 15 characters or more significantly increases the complexity and time required for an attacker to crack it.

Consider using a passphrase instead of a password. A passphrase is a memorable sentence or phrase that is easy for you to remember but difficult for others to guess. Combine unrelated words and include variations in capitalization and punctuation to further strengthen it. Even a simple, easily recalled phrase can be a powerful security tool.

Should I use the same password for all my accounts?

No, using the same password for multiple accounts is a significant security risk. If one of your accounts is compromised, all accounts using the same password are automatically vulnerable. This creates a domino effect, allowing attackers to gain access to sensitive information across various platforms.

Instead, use unique passwords for each of your online accounts. While remembering multiple complex passwords can seem daunting, password managers can greatly simplify the process. They securely store your passwords and can even generate strong, random passwords for you.

What is a password manager, and how does it work?

A password manager is a software application that securely stores and manages your passwords. It typically works by encrypting your passwords and storing them in a secure vault, protected by a master password. You only need to remember the master password to access all your other passwords.

Password managers can also generate strong, random passwords for you, making it easier to use unique passwords for each account. Most password managers offer browser extensions that automatically fill in your passwords when you visit a website, streamlining the login process. They also often include features like security audits and password breach monitoring.

How often should I change my passwords?

While there’s no universally agreed-upon frequency for changing passwords, it’s generally recommended to update them periodically, especially for critical accounts. Changing passwords every 3-6 months is a good practice, but the most important factor is to monitor for any signs of compromise.

If you receive a notification about a data breach affecting an account you use, change your password immediately, even if you haven’t experienced any suspicious activity. Consider enabling two-factor authentication (2FA) whenever possible to add an extra layer of security to your accounts, even if your password is compromised.

What is two-factor authentication (2FA), and how does it enhance security?

Two-factor authentication (2FA) adds an extra layer of security to your accounts by requiring a second form of verification in addition to your password. This second factor can be something you have (like a code sent to your phone) or something you are (like a fingerprint or facial recognition).

Even if someone manages to guess or steal your password, they won’t be able to access your account without this second factor. Enabling 2FA significantly reduces the risk of unauthorized access and provides a strong defense against phishing attacks and other forms of account compromise. Most major online services offer 2FA options, and it’s highly recommended that you enable it whenever possible.

Leave a Comment